17 nov 1919 - Volin (at some point)testifies to the rev. tribunal of 14th army of the many company's he's recieved about kontrraz. makhno shuts him down, recalling the assistance they have paid to Volin, including accompanying him north for a lecture (when he was arrested)

Description:

A severe critic of the Kontrrazvedka, not only in the autumn of 1919 but also later in emigration, was the head of
this Commission and chair of the VRS, Vsevolod Volin. In the deposition he gave to the revo-
lutionary tribunal of the 14th Army he stated
that he had to deal with a whole procession of
complainants on account of the abuses of the
Kontrrazvedka, an organ which he regarded
with horror. 107
Makhno himself recalled that the Kon-
trrazvedka was given practically unlimited
powers in the liberated regions. This applied, in particular, to the
searching of homes in the zone of military operations or the arrest
of persons, especially those identified by the local population. The
Batko acknowledged that some of the actions of the Kontrrazvedka
caused him "mental anguish and embarrassment when he had to
apologize for their excesses.”(108) On the other hand, Makhno categorically rejected Volin's critique. According to the Batko, Volin
himself frequently turned to the Kontrrazvedka for help. Thus in
Yekaterinoslav he and the Bolshevik Orlov asked for a warrant to
search the property of an anarchist who had defected to Denikin
and confiscate any goods for the local committee of the KP(b)U.
And when Volin made a trip to Krivy Rog to deliver a lecture (he was arrested there by the Reds) in the autumn of 1919 he was accompanied by Golik personally with a squad of 20 of the best agents
of the Kontrrazvedkalom.
